Birdwatching Extravaganza:
Kenya boasts a birdwatcher's paradise, with over 1,100 species of birds recorded within its borders. The jungle safaris take you to some of the prime birding locations, such as Kakamega Forest and the Taita Hills. Vibrant sunbirds, majestic eagles, and colorful turacos are just a few examples of the avian wonders awaiting discovery in Kenya's lush jungles. Birdwatchers will be enchanted by the kaleidoscope of colors and melodious tunes that fill the air.
The Enigmatic Kakamega Forest:
For a truly immersive jungle safari experience, a visit to Kakamega Forest is a must. Often referred to as the last remnant of the ancient Guineo-Congolian rainforest that once spanned the continent, Kakamega is a biodiversity hotspot. Here, towering trees create a canopy that houses various primate species, including the endangered De Brazza's monkey and the elusive Colobus monkey. The forest floor is a haven for reptiles, insects, and a myriad of plant species, making every step a journey into the heart of untouched wilderness.
